The Geography of Thin Air: Understanding the Challenge
Cusco does not just sit high; it dominates the landscape of the southern Peruvian Andes. For the uninitiated, the physics of altitude are simple but brutal: as you ascend, the barometric pressure drops. While the percentage of oxygen in the air remains the same (roughly 21%), the molecules are spread further apart. At 11,000 feet, you are breathing in approximately 30% less oxygen with every inhalation than you would at sea level.
For those flying directly into Cusco from low-altitude hubs, the physiological shock is profound. The body’s response—increased heart rate, hyperventilation, and, in many cases, acute mountain sickness (AMS)—is not a sign of weakness, but a biological scramble to compensate for the sudden lack of oxygen saturation.

She didn’t argue. She simply pointed toward a quiet alcove in the lobby where an array of natural remedies awaited. There was mate de coca, a traditional herbal infusion made from the leaves of the coca plant—a mild stimulant long used by Andean cultures to combat fatigue and hypoxia. Alongside it was muña, an Andean mint tea favored for evening consumption due to its caffeine-free properties. I drank the coca tea with the swagger of a man who thought he had outsmarted geography.

Supporting Data and Medical Realities
While my experience was punctuated by romantic train rides and ancient ruins, the clinical reality of high-altitude travel is well-documented. According to the Wilderness Medical Society, AMS typically presents within 6 to 12 hours of arrival at altitude. Symptoms range from headaches and nausea to, in severe cases, High-Altitude Pulmonary Edema (HAPE) or Cerebral Edema (HACE), both of which are life-threatening.

Official Responses and Traveler Safety
Hotels in Cusco, particularly high-end establishments like the Marriott, are well-versed in the risks posed to international travelers. They maintain strict protocols, including on-call medical staff and oxygen-enriched rooms, to ensure guest safety.
"The most important thing for travelers to understand is that altitude sickness is not a reflection of fitness," says Dr. Elena Rodriguez, a local specialist in travel medicine. "We see elite athletes struggle just as much as casual vacationers. The key is acclimatization—spending time at lower elevations, staying hydrated, and avoiding alcohol during the first 48 hours."
